Output 103321e17f9c70ea64d355606db3593d78ee3f83b22231d3b307a03a7370b05f:76

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f5aa3d9db9467e5b65500297cbd720e2e452c79bca55253e77b53beb447fa17a
address
bc1p7k4rm8degel9ke2sq2tuh4equtj993umef2j20nhk5a7k3rl59aqadxtkv
transaction
103321e17f9c70ea64d355606db3593d78ee3f83b22231d3b307a03a7370b05f
spent
true